Kings County Museum’s Harvest Fest Show and Shine

Kentville Centre Square Kentville, Canada

The Kings Historical Society is hosting a classic car show in Centre Square in Kentville. Registration starts at 8:30 a.m. car show from 10-2 p.m. on Saturday, Oct 9. Open to all vintage and classic cars, prizes presented for Best in Show, People’s Choice and the top 10 vehicles chosen by drivers. This fundraiser will […]

Focus on Nature

Kings County Museum

Richard Stern is an avid nature photographer. He will be showing highlights of his work and offering tips and techniques for capturing nature in a special presentation on May 3. Hosted by the Kings Historical Society. Members of the public are welcome to attend, Richard Stern will share his photography tips for capturing nature.
